Tenderize refers to the process of making meat softer and easier to chew by breaking down its fibers. This can be achieved through mechanical means, such as pounding with a mallet, or through the use of marinades containing enzymes or acids. Tenderizing meat is a common practice in cooking to ensure that tougher cuts of meat become palatable and enjoyable to eat.
